What items should I pack for overseas travel?

Here are some essential items you should consider packing for your overseas travel:

  • Passport and travel documents
  • Clothes suitable for the destination’s weather
  • Comfortable shoes
  • Toiletries and personal hygiene products
  • Medications and first aid kit
  • Adapters and chargers for electronic devices
  • Cash and/or credit cards
  • Travel insurance details
  • Travel itinerary and important contact numbers

Can I pack liquid items in my carry-on luggage?

When packing your carry-on luggage for overseas travel, you are allowed to bring liquid items, but they must comply with the regulations set by the Transportation Security Administration (TSA). Here are the TSA guidelines for liquids in carry-on baggage:

  • Liquid containers must be 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) or less
  • All liquid containers must fit in a single quart-sized bag
  • Each passenger is allowed only one quart-sized bag of liquids
  • The quart-sized bag must be placed in a screening bin for security inspection

Should I pack valuables in my checked luggage or carry-on?

It is recommended to pack valuables such as passport, travel documents, electronics, and expensive jewelry in your carry-on luggage. This way, you can keep them with you at all times and minimize the risk of loss or theft. Checked luggage can sometimes be mishandled or delayed during travel, so it’s best to keep your valuables close to you.

Do I need to pack a power adapter for overseas travel?

Yes, if you’re traveling to a country with different electrical outlets and voltage, it’s essential to pack a power adapter. This will allow you to charge your electronic devices using the local power sockets. Make sure to research the specific type of adapter needed for your destination country and pack it accordingly.

How can I pack efficiently for overseas travel?

Here are some tips for efficient packing for overseas travel:

  • Make a packing list and stick to it
  • Roll your clothes instead of folding to save space
  • Maximize the use of packing cubes or compression bags
  • Choose versatile clothing items that can be mixed and matched
  • Pack travel-sized toiletries or purchase them at your destination
  • Minimize the number of shoes by packing versatile and comfortable pairs
  • Wear your bulkiest items on the plane to save suitcase space
  • Consider doing laundry during your trip instead of packing excessive clothes
